Not considered.; Not carefully planned or thought through beforehand. (of an action or statement)
— He proteſted to him, […] that this Flight of his ſhou'd be look'd on as a heat of Youth, and raſhneſs of a too forward Courage, and an unconſider'd impatience of Liberty, and no more; […]
-
Not considered.; Not noticed; not considered worthy of notice.
— My father […] was likewise a snapper-up of unconsidered trifles.
